One cylinder has a volume that is 8 Centimeters cubed less than StartFraction 7 over 8 EndFraction of the volume of a second cyl

inder. If the first cylinder’s volume is 216 Centimeters cubed, what is the correct equation and value of x, the volume of the second cylinder?

The correct equation is:

216 = \frac{7}{8} \times x - 8

The volume of second cylinder is 256 centimeter cubed

<em><u>Solution:</u></em>

Given that,

One cylinder has a volume that is 8cm less than 7/8 of the volume of a second cylinder

The first cylinder’s volume is 216 centimeter cubed

From given,

Let "x" be the volume of second cylinder

Therefore,

Volume of first cylinder = 7/8 of the volume of a second cylinder - 8

216 = \frac{7}{8} \times x - 8

216 = \frac{7x}{8}-8\\\\216 = \frac{7x-64}{8}\\\\7x - 64 = 8 \times 216\\\\7x - 64 = 1728\\\\7x = 1728 + 64\\\\7x = 1792\\\\Divide\ both\ sides\ by\ 7\\\\x = 256

Thus the volume of second cylinder is 256 centimeter cubed
